Stratigraphy, sedimentology, and paleomagnetism of the Coral Ridge sand body, eastern Taylor Valley, Victoria Land, Antarctica
Donald Parker Elston, Paul H. Robinson, Stephen L. Bressler
1981, Open-File Report 81-1303
A body of moderately well sorted and well stratified ice-cemented sand, here informally called the Coral Ridge sand body, was deposited across eastern Taylor Valley before the deposition of a veneer of glaciogenic deposits related to late Pleistocene incursions of the Ross Sea ice sheet.
